Artificial Intelligence in Achieving Sustainable Development Goals

Ricardo Vinuesa; Hossein Azizpour; Iolanda Leite; Madeline Balaam; Virginia Dignum; Sami Domisch; Anna Felländer; Simone Daniela Langhans; Max Tegmark; Francesco Fuso Nerini · 2020-01-13

AI can support sustainable development but also poses risks, requiring regulation to ensure transparency, safety, and ethical standards.

20 Gigawatts in Orbit: Starcloud's Plan for AI Compute

Philip Johnston is the co-founder and CEO of Starcloud, the company building data centers in space. In November 2025, Starcloud launched an Nvidia H100 GPU into orbit and trained the first large language model in space. They've since raised $200 million, hit a billion-dollar valuation just 17 months after YC demo day and filed with the FCC to deploy 88,000 more satellites. In this episode, Philip walks us through their wild origin story, the engineering challenges behind the Starcloud-1, why they booked a SpaceX launch before they even knew what they were building and how data centers in space make sense both economically and politically.
